The Foundation: Analyze Your Material Stream<\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>Before looking at machine specs, you must scientifically analyze your raw material. The &#8220;form&#8221; of your plastic dictates the feeding system, while the &#8220;type&#8221; dictates the screw design.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h4 class=\"wp-block-heading\">1.1 Material Form &amp; Bulk Density<\/h4>\n\n\n\n<ul class=\"wp-block-list\">\n<li><strong>Films &amp; Woven Bags (Low Density):<\/strong> Soft plastics like LDPE films, PP woven bags, and BOPP scraps are light and &#8220;fluffy.&#8221; They are difficult to feed into a standard extruder.\n<ul class=\"wp-block-list\">\n<li><em>The Solution:<\/em> You need a <strong>Compactor-Pelletizing System<\/strong>. This integrates a cutter-compactor that pre-heats and densifies the film before forcing it into the screw.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li><strong>Rigid Flakes (High Density):<\/strong> Materials like crushed HDPE bottles, PP crates, or ABS lumps have high bulk density.\n<ul class=\"wp-block-list\">\n<li><em>The Solution:<\/em> A standard <strong>Single Screw Extruder<\/strong> with a force feeder or hopper loader is usually sufficient and more cost-effective.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li><strong>Foams (EPS\/EPE):<\/strong> These require specialized cold compactors or melting systems due to their extreme volume-to-weight ratio.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n\n\n\n<h4 class=\"wp-block-heading\">1.2 Material Condition<\/h4>\n\n\n\n<ul class=\"wp-block-list\">\n<li><strong>Moisture Content:<\/strong> Washed flakes often retain moisture. If your material has >5% moisture, you need a specialized <strong>Double-Vented Degassing System<\/strong> to prevent &#8220;foamy&#8221; pellets.<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li><strong>Contamination:<\/strong> Paper labels, ink, or dust require a high-performance melt filter (screen changer) to ensure the final pellets are clean and market-ready.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n\n\n\n<hr class=\"wp-block-separator has-alpha-channel-opacity\"\/>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\">2. The Engine: Single Screw vs. Twin Screw Extruders<\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>The core of your <a href=\"https:\/\/www.recyclemachine.net\/plastic-pelletizers\/\">plastic granulation line<\/a> is the extruder. Which one do you need?<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h4 class=\"wp-block-heading\">2.1 <a href=\"https:\/\/www.recyclemachine.net\/single-screw-plastic-pelletizing-machines\/\">Single Screw Extruder<\/a><\/h4>\n\n\n\n<ul class=\"wp-block-list\">\n<li><strong>Best For:<\/strong> Recycling clean, pre-crushed materials of the same type (e.g., clean PP regrind).<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li><strong>Pros:<\/strong> Lower cost, easier maintenance, stable pressure build-up.<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li><strong>Rumtoo Insight:<\/strong> For most recycling applications, a high-quality single screw with a proper L\/D (Length-to-Diameter) ratio (typically 30:1 or 32:1) offers the best balance of efficiency and cost.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n\n\n\n<h4 class=\"wp-block-heading\">2.2 <a href=\"https:\/\/www.recyclemachine.net\/advanced-twin-screw-compounding-pelletizing-line-for-versatile-polymer-processing\/\">Twin Screw Extruder<\/a><\/h4>\n\n\n\n<ul class=\"wp-block-list\">\n<li><strong>Best For:<\/strong> Compounding (mixing different plastics), highly sensitive materials (PVC), or when high devolatilization (removing heavy inks\/moisture) is needed.<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li><strong>Pros:<\/strong> Superior mixing capability and temperature control.<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li><strong>Rumtoo Insight:<\/strong> If you are modifying plastics (e.g., adding calcium carbonate to PP), a twin-screw is mandatory.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n\n\n\n<hr class=\"wp-block-separator has-alpha-channel-opacity\"\/>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\">3. The Shape of Success: Choosing the Right Pelletizing System<\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>Many buyers overlook this, but <em>how<\/em> you cut the plastic determines the quality and shape of your final product.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h4 class=\"wp-block-heading\">3.1 Water Ring (Die-Face) Pelletizing<\/h4>\n\n\n\n<ul class=\"wp-block-list\">\n<li><strong>Mechanism:<\/strong> Blades cut the hot plastic immediately as it exits the die face, flinging pellets into a water ring for cooling.<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li><strong>Best For:<\/strong> <strong>PE and PP films.<\/strong> These materials flow easily and cut well while hot. The result is a flat, round pellet (lens shape) preferred by film manufacturers.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n\n\n\n<h4 class=\"wp-block-heading\">3.2 Strand Pelletizing<\/h4>\n\n\n\n<ul class=\"wp-block-list\">\n<li><strong>Mechanism:<\/strong> Plastic is extruded into long &#8220;spaghetti&#8221; strands, cooled in a water bath, and then cut by a granulator.<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li><strong>Best For:<\/strong> <strong>Engineering plastics (ABS, PA), PET, and rigid PP\/HDPE.<\/strong> It produces cylindrical pellets.<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li><strong>Note:<\/strong> Requires more operator skill to thread the strands during startup but offers excellent versatility.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n\n\n\n<h4 class=\"wp-block-heading\">3.3 Underwater Pelletizing<\/h4>\n\n\n\n<ul class=\"wp-block-list\">\n<li><strong>Mechanism:<\/strong> Cutting happens entirely underwater.<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li><strong>Best For:<\/strong> High-volume production and sticky materials (like TPU). It ensures perfectly spherical pellets but comes with a higher initial investment.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n\n\n\n<hr class=\"wp-block-separator has-alpha-channel-opacity\"\/>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\">4. Critical Components that Define Quality<\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>At Rumtoo, we manufacture our equipment in-house to control the quality of these vital components: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<ol class=\"wp-block-list\">\n<li><strong>The Gearbox:<\/strong> This is the muscle of the machine. Look for high-torque, precision-ground gearboxes that can run 24\/7 without overheating.<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li><strong>The Screw &amp; Barrel:<\/strong> For recycling abrasive dirty plastics, standard steel isn&#8217;t enough. We use <strong>bimetallic screws<\/strong> treated for wear resistance to extend machine life by years.<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li><strong>The Screen Changer:<\/strong> Stopping the machine to change dirty screens kills productivity.\n<ul class=\"wp-block-list\">\n<li><em>Recommendation:<\/em> Use a <strong>Hydraulic Screen Changer<\/strong> (non-stop). It allows you to swap filters in seconds without shutting down the line.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<\/li>\n<\/ol>\n\n\n\n<hr class=\"wp-block-separator has-alpha-channel-opacity\"\/>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\">5. Production Scale &amp; Automation<\/h3>\n\n\n\n<h4 class=\"wp-block-heading\">5.1 Sizing Your Machine<\/h4>\n\n\n\n<p>Don&#8217;t just buy the biggest machine. An oversized machine running at 30% capacity wastes energy.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<ul class=\"wp-block-list\">\n<li><strong>Small Scale (100-300 kg\/h):<\/strong> Ideal for in-house recycling of factory scraps.<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li><strong>Industrial Scale (500-1000+ kg\/h):<\/strong> Required for dedicated recycling plants. Rumtoo offers high-output lines with energy-saving motors to keep operational costs low.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n\n\n\n<h4 class=\"wp-block-heading\">5.2 Smart Controls<\/h4>\n\n\n\n<p>Modern recycling requires data. Look for PLC control panels (like Siemens or Omron) that offer: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<ul class=\"wp-block-list\">\n<li><strong>One-touch start\/stop.<\/strong><\/li>\n\n\n\n<li><strong>Automatic temperature regulation.<\/strong><\/li>\n\n\n\n<li><strong>Safety interlocks<\/strong> (prevents the machine from starting if the temperature isn&#8217;t high enough, protecting the screw).<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n\n\n\n<hr class=\"wp-block-separator has-alpha-channel-opacity\"\/>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\">6. We customize the screw geometry, L\/D ratio, and feeding system based on <em>your<\/em> material.<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li><strong>Global Support:<\/strong> From installation to training your staff, our team ensures your line is running at peak performance from Day 1.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n\n\n\n<hr class=\"wp-block-separator has-alpha-channel-opacity\"\/>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\">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)<\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p><strong>Q: Can one machine process both PE Film and Rigid HDPE?<\/strong><br>A: Generally, no. Films require a compactor feeder and usually a water-ring pelletizer. Rigid plastics use a standard hopper and strand pelletizer. While some &#8220;universal&#8221; machines exist, specialized machines offer much higher efficiency and pellet quality.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p><strong>Q: How often do I need to change the screen filter?<\/strong><br>A: It depends on contamination. For clean factory scraps, maybe once a shift. For washed post-consumer waste, you might change it every 30-60 minutes. This is why a Hydraulic Screen Changer is essential for dirty materials.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p><strong>Q: What is the lifespan of a Rumtoo screw and barrel?<\/strong><br>A: With proper maintenance and our bimetallic treatment, our screws are designed to last years, even under continuous industrial operation.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<hr class=\"wp-block-separator has-alpha-channel-opacity\"\/>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\">Conclusion<\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>Choosing the right plastic granulation line is a balance of material science, engineering requirements, and production goals.
